Are tie tacks out of style? Tie tacks are derece generally part of mainstream mens style anymore, but they are used to make a bold, vintage statement in menswear (similar to wearing a pocket watch or handlebar mustache). Tie tacks fell out of fashion in the 1960s when keeper loops began holding ties in place.[13] X Research source

If your tie is too long, ensure you are starting with the correct lengths of Burada the wide and narrow ends. If it’s still too long, consider adjusting the starting position of the wide end. Conversely, if your tie is too short, start with a longer wide end.
